Looking for GetEstore.com Store Owners
Hi,
I recently purchased a GetEstore.com online store. It seemed like a great idea at the time to start making money, but now, I am having second thoughts about the integrity of the company.
Firstly, nobody ever responds to my emails. I'm beginning to think that all the emails go into a black hole somewhere.
Secondly, nobody ever picks up the phone. I always get the voicemail greeting, and then I am notified that the voicemail box is full. There doesn't seem to be any way to contact them!
Thirdly, as I become more concerned, I started doing some research online by typing in 'GetEstore scam' on Google, which is something I should have done prior to getting the store. Wowserz, were there a lot of results! There were claims that items are not sent, and checks were not mailed.
Lastly, as I had recently sold a few products on eBay, and when I visited my store to purchase the items, I was shocked to find out that the product I had sold has been marked 'Out of Stock' and 'Discontinued.' I realize that this happens, but with 7 day auctions and 60 day sale periods, how can you predict when a product is no longer available?
I have also made a few sales elsewhere. As I had already purchased the items through the website, I am now concerned that the products will not be shipped. Also, when I made the purchase, my billing address was different from the shipping address (which is what they asked us to do). Later on in the day, I received an email that asked me to fill out a form and fax it back to them along with a copy of my driver's license and credit card to ensure the security of the transaction. After doing so, I emailed them and called them to make sure that they had received the documents and that the orders would be shipped promptly. No response.
For all you GetEstore.com store owners out there, can you verify that this is a legit dropshipping company - that checks are mailed and products are sent? I would like to know, as I'm sure we all would, if I am getting scammed.

Questions on GetEstore.com & Universal Banner Network,Inc.
Need some help if possible. I think I am being ripped off.
Back in Jan. '06 I was contacted by GetEstore from Phoenix, Az and pitched a program to get 20,000 shoppers to my store. I didn't have a store but I was told no problem. I was told about the Advanced level at a cost of $875 for a 6 month fee and would get me 20,000 shoppers and if in 6 months time if I did not double that in sales, I would not have to pay for the second 6 months--it was on them. They were going to set me up and it sure seemed like not a bad deal. I was told that they would send me a packet and I would need to sign the (?) contract/agreement and fax it back to them. They did send me an email to congradulate me on this decision. Three seconds later, (I kid you not, I checked the email time) I received an email from Universal Banner Network, Inc charging me $59.95 for my 'store'. Did not know who these people were or what this was about and checked my bank statement and that fee never went through my account. I did call the Az. number and asked them who UBN and told them about this email and charge and what did they know and they said they didn't know anythng about them and 'don't have anything to do with them.' AND, that I should not be charged anything extra from anyone! Okay. I find that the customer support contact form has UBN's mailing address at the bottom of the page. What's going on?!
Time passes and I never received the paper work or email, or phone calls--nothing. After leaving several messages on the main line I finally get someone and ask for the person that was suppose to be my rep. He is no longer there and I now have his supervisor in charge of my account. He does not know what happened but he will now do all the follow-up. Now same story---going to send packet, etc. This time he says because they screwed up, that my store will be set up within a weeks time. Actually, he said 3-5 days time and it was like 10 days. I'm charged the $875 and it did go through in April. Now, I am under the impression that I am buying a store for this amount with 1730 products and the guarantee of 20,000 shoppers and am still waiting for papers to sign. Okay, still never got anything in the mail and they said they mailed it and so forth. I never signed anything. Tryed to contact my rep again and he's not available but the office manager will now handle all my questions. I was not getting the satisfaction I needed from her and asked to please speak to her supervisor. I was told that would be the owner and he is not available nor does he have a phone number that I can call and SHE handles the problems. I can write but that was it. Now I am getting nervous. I was just informed that what I actually bought was an advertizing package and not a store---but no one told me that up front. I did not go on their site and go into 'setting up your store', so how would I know any different.
I admit its after the fact but I started doing some research on these guys. 'F' rating on the BBB. Owned by UBN in LA and these people tell me that their logo at the bottom of the GetEstore.com is there only because they are using UBN's templates. That's interesting, but they don't know anything about UBN and there are no other main GetEstore.com's out there. Then on ripoffreport.com, there is about 5 pages of not so nice things about them. Reports of not receiving their money for months on end, defective merchandise, very slow delivery and follow up on returns is not to great, unhappy customers and in most cases the individual store owners are stuck holding the bag.
I think they are operating just barely within the law and that is what concerns me the most. Has anyone tried to get their money back? I checked with my bank and they said that since this company did build me a store---even though I never signed anything and thought it was part of the fee I paid, that I most likely can not get my money back.
I have discovered that the store cost you $49.94 a year and $20.00 to set it up---wonder why I was not told that up front? I have found that in the terms of agreement, of which I never received,but is on their site under Acknowledgments--it states "At any time upon request by GetEstore.com, you agree to sign a non-electric version of this Agreement." I hope that is my saving grace.
I don't want to take them down or anything like that, I just want to leave them alone and me----get my money back. Anyone, comments please.

It's been my experience and opinion that buying into "Turnkey" stores that already supply products for you to sell from is a waste of money and time. These types of deals are usually non-cost effective b/c everyone's selling the same products and a middlelman is in between the store owner and the products bumping the prices up even more. The only way to make money online in terms of selling products is either stock them yourself and ship them out or dropship them from a dropship supplier. Either way, you'll need to be a legitimate business to do this.
